Residents of central Missouri had a chance to attend an exciting hot air balloon event last weekend. The 2008 Columbia Balloon Invitational was labeled a success by local authorities. Estimates put the number of attendees at 30,000.
There something visually invigorating about watching hot air balloons fly - which is why the Missouri Lottery sponsors a balloon team that competes in events like last weekend. In addition to a race, events usually include a night flame, where tethered balloons fire the tanks to illuminate the balloon against the night sky.
